Quiet-Sun conditions continue with the target region NOAA 11660 remaining unchanged. The region retains its beta-gamma configuration and was the source of an isolated B6.6 flare at 16:16 UT today. No significant increase in activity expected over the next 24 hours.
The position of NOAA 11660 on 24-Jan-2013 at 18:00 UT is:
N13W53, ( 760", 273" )
